在Python中,计算程序运行时间可以通过多种方式实现。以下是几种常见的方法,每种方法都遵循你提供的tips,并附有相应的代码示例: 方法一:使用 time 模块 time 模块中的 time() 函数可以返回当前时间的时间戳(以秒为单位)。通过记录代码执行前后的时间戳,并计算它们之间的差值,即可得到程序的执行时间。 python import...
Python 计算程序运行时长的方法有多种,常见的有:使用time模块、使用datetime模块、使用timeit模块、使用perf_counter函数。其中,最常用的是time模块和timeit模块。本文将详细介绍这几种方法,并给出具体的代码示例和性能分析。 一、使用time模块 time模块是 Python 标准库中的一个模块,提供了多种与时间相关的函数。通过...
Python计算程序运行时间 方法1importdatetime starttime=datetime.datetime.now()#code running...endtime=datetime.datetime.now()print(endtime -starttime).seconds 方法2start=time.time()#code ...end=time.time()printend-start 方法3 start=time.clock()#code ...end=time.clock()printend-start 上面3...
import time def test(): start_time = time.time() # 记录程序开始运行时间 s = 0 for i in range(1000000): s += 1 end_time = time.time() # 记录程序结束运行时间 print('cost %f second' % (end_time - start_time)) return s s=test() print(s) 1. 2. 3. 4. 5. 6. 7. 8....
这篇文章主要介绍了python计算程序开始到程序结束的运行时间和程序运行的CPU时间的三个方法,大家参考使用 执行时间 方法1 复制代码代码如下: importdatetimestarttime = datetime.datetime.now() #long running endtime = datetime.datetime.now() print (endtime - starttime).seconds ...
python如何计算程序运行时间,这里小编提供2种方法:工具/原料 惠普14 windows10专业版 python3.6.4 方法/步骤 1 python 计算程序运行用时,主要有两种方法:time.time() 和 time.clock()。二者都需要导入time库。2 time.time()使用需要导入time库,具体操作如下:3 time.clock()使用需要导入clock库,具体...
Python 计算程序运行时间,首先需要导入 time 模块。 关于time 模块 : 计算程序运行时间: 方法①:time.clock()(此处已试过,换成time.time() 也是可以正确得出计时结果的) importtimedefstart_sleep(): time.sleep(3)if__name__=='__main__':#The start timestart =time.clock()#A program which will ru...
每个 Python 脚本都需要一些时间来执行文件,可以使用以下方法进行计算。使用time模块在 Python 中,可以使用 time 模块,测量代码块执行所花费的时间。time 模块的 time() 函数以秒为单位返回时间,计算开始时间和结束时间的差值,得到给定代码块的执行时间。import timestart_time = time.time()for i in range(...
1 Python语言 1.1 time.time() -->float 描述:返回自纪元(大部分系统为1970年1月1日00:00:00(UTC))以来的秒数。尽管返回的是浮点数,但并非所有系统的精度都能优于1秒。Return the time in seconds since the epoch as a floating-point number. Note that even though the time is always returned as ...
计算Python的某个程序,或者是代码块运行的时间一般有三种方法。 方法一 import datetimestart=datetime.datetime.now() run_function(): # do somethingend=datetime.datetime.now() print (end-start) 1 2 3 4 5 6 7 运行结果显示: 方法二: importtimestart=time.time() ...